L to R: Karl Tschacha and Mark Wright

Mark Wright has assumed the role at the helm of Schreiner Group. He has been serving as CFO of the company since the beginning of the year, with responsibility for the commercial activities of all four locations in Oberschleissheim, Dorfen, New York, and Shanghai. He succeeds Karl Tschacha, who held the role for 15 years. Tschacha is switching to the role of a senior management consultant. In that role he is going to make his expertise available to senior management, the advisory council, and the shareholders’ meeting in 2026.

“Schreiner Group has impressed me with its innovative prowess, its internationality, and its clear growth strategy,” said Mark Wright. “The CFO role combines classic financial responsibility with strategic subjects such as digitalization. This combination makes this role particularly attractive.” Wright sees major potential for all business units, especially in terms of RFID. He said,“The market is clearly evolving away from the simple label toward data-based value-adding solutions. RFID, digitalization, and smart data are decisive growth drivers for our target markets.”

In addition to finance, controlling, and purchasing, Mark Wright is responsible for IT and facility management plus commercial controlling of the international entities. A special focus is placed on Schreiner Group’s further internationalization, extension of the company’s foreign business, optimization of cost structures, and sustainable increase of profitability – in view of a currently challenging global economic environment. “We’re in economically turbulent times,” said Wright. “That’s why it’s all the more important to combine commercial stability with strategic foresight and to systematically invest in forward-thinking areas.”

“With high professional expertise, foresight, and great personal dedication, Karl Tschacha has made a major contribution to Schreiner Group’s success,” said Roland Schreiner, Schreiner Group’s CEO. “We expressly thank him for his long-standing commitment and his achievements.”

Mark Wright said, “I’ve found a well-structured environment. The relevant subjects have been thoroughly thought through, and the collaboration in the commercial setting is shaped by open-mindedness and high professionalism.”

CEO Roland Schreiner said, “In Mark Wright, we’re gaining a CFO with strong international experience and a strategic view. He’s going to provide important impetus for economically controlling and achieving further growth of Schreiner Group.”
